I am a senior in high school living in New jersey and I've been 18 now for about a month. I have recently got a job at target. I am still unsure if i still have labor restriction. I don't know if i am only allowed to work 4 hour shifts a day, max, no more than 20 hours a week, and can't be scheduled too early or too late. Do these restrictions still apply in New Jersey if I am 18 but still in high school?

you are an adult at 18 and can decide how you want to live your life and how you want to be employed. nevertheless, i would not let the job interfere with high school. ed dimon, esq.
